Overview
Explore the deployment of Kafka-based microservices on Kubernetes using service mesh technology in this informative conference talk. Learn how to integrate Apache Kafka® messaging with Kuma service mesh to facilitate efficient communication between synchronous and asynchronous microservices. Discover the benefits and relevance of combining these technologies for improved microservices connectivity in container-managed environments. Gain insights into deploying vanilla Kafka and Kafka Connect components alongside Kuma, addressing the challenges of microservice-based architectures in modern cloud-native applications.
